What P0446 means
Source: SAE J2012 / OBD-IIA fault in the evaporative vent control circuit.
A stored code names the test that failed, never the part that caused it. It is the starting point of a diagnosis, not its conclusion — the same code has several possible causes and the cheap one is not always right.

Does a code mean the car is recalled?
No. Recalls are filed by campaign and matched by VIN, and none of them are triggered by a scan tool. If you want to know whether an open recall applies to one specific vehicle, check the VIN at nhtsa.gov/recalls — that is the only source that settles it.

Will clearing the code fix it?
Clearing turns the light off and erases the freeze-frame data a technician would have used to work out what happened. If the condition is still there the code returns, usually within a few drive cycles, and the diagnosis now starts from less information than before.
